Job description

Description

The Rewind Operator is responsible for converting large rolls of printed and non-printed labels into specified quantities for shipping, splicing and rewinding end or remnant rolls into reusable rolls.

Primary Duties and Responsibilities
  • Converts large rolls of printed and non-printed labels into specific quantities as requested by the customer.
  • Slits labels into correct size if necessary
  • Completes score sheets which calculates the amount of work being performed.
  • Cleans work area
  • Lifts between 10 and 75 pound rolls of paper
  • Bag and organize rolls on carts for Shipping
  • Performs other duties as assigned
